Nepali team for ACC U-19 Asia Cup announced

KATHMANDU:- The Nepali squad set to compete in the ACC U-19 Asia Cup taking place in the United Arab Emirates (UAE) from December 12 onward has been officially announced.

The Cricket Association of Nepal (CAN) announced a 15-member team led by Captain Ashok Dhami. The lineup features Neeraj Kumar Yadav, Dilshad Ali, Abhishek Tiwari, Sibrin Shrestha, Sahil Patel, Dayanand Mandal, Nischal Chhetri, Asish Lohar, Nitesh Patel, Chandan Ramaroshan BK, Bipin Sharma, Vansh Chhetri, and Yubaraj Khatri.

Nepal’s opening match is set against Sri Lanka on December 13. Following this, Nepal will face Bangladesh on December 15, and then Afghanistan on December 17. All these matches will take place at the Sevens Stadium. The tournament will feature eight competing teams.

Group ‘A’ includes India, Pakistan, UAE, and Malaysia, while Group ‘B’ consists of Bangladesh, Sri Lanka, Afghanistan, and Nepal. Matches will be held at both the ICC Academy and the Sevens Stadium.

The top two teams from each group will advance to the semifinals scheduled for December 19. The final match is slated for December 21. RSS
